Bringing a Personal Point of View: Evaluating Dynamic 3D Gaussian Splatting for Egocentric Scene Reconstruction

ArXi:2604.23803v1 Announce Type: new Egocentric video provides a unique view into human perception and interaction, with growing relevance for augmented reality, robotics, and assistive technologies. However, rapid camera motion and complex scene dynamics pose major challenges for 3D reconstruction from this perspective. While 3D Gaussian Splatting (3DGS) has become a state-of-the-art method for efficient, high-quality novel view synthesis, variants, that focus on reconstructing dynamic scenes from monocular video are rarely evaluated on egocentric video.
